What to Expect

When we do your renovation we bring over 30 years of process to your project.

From the first time you call we're listening to your needs and already working towards helping you realize your dreams.

Our process:

  1. Introduce you to Litwiller, our history and our processes
  2. Discuss the scope of work
  3. Give you a rough budget based on ballpark figures
  4. Review the site (your home)
  5. Take notes and photographs
  6. Establish Scope of Work
  7. Generate an Estimate (revisions as required)
  8. Establish a start date
  9. Sign the agreement and accept deposit
  10. Selections, selections and more selections
  11. Site preparation
  12. Trade and Supplier coordination
  13. The work is happening in the home
  14. Change orders processed as required
  15. Final clean
  16. Customer walk-through and final review
